Comprehending Mesothelioma and Its Causes
Mesothelioma usually develops from breathing in asbestos fibers, which can cause swelling and scarring in the lungs and other body organs gradually. Asbestos was extensively utilized in various industries due to its fireproof properties, however its threats were not totally acknowledged up until years later on.
Typical Asbestos Exposure Sites in LouisianaIndustryLocationsPotential Asbestos SourcesShipbuildingNew Orleans, AvondaleInsulation, gaskets, and ship hullsOil RefineriesBaton Rouge, Lake CharlesInsulation, pipes, and tank liningsBuildingStatewideInsulating products, flooring tilesManufacturingBossier City, LafayetteBrake linings, electrical insulationLegal Framework Surrounding Mesothelioma Claims
Louisiana law supplies legal opportunities for mesothelioma victims and their families to pursue compensation from responsible parties. Understanding the various kinds of legal actions available is vital for those impacted.
Kinds Of Legal Actions
Injury Lawsuits: Filed by mesothelioma victims seeking compensation for medical expenditures, pain and suffering, and loss of income.

Wrongful Death Claims: Filed by relative of people who have yielded to mesothelioma, aiming to recover damages for loss of friendship, funeral expenditures, and more.

Asbestos Trust Fund Claims: Many companies responsible for asbestos exposure have actually developed trust funds to compensate victims. Navigating trust claims can be made complex but potentially rewarding.

Workers' Compensation Claims: If the exposure occurred in the workplace, victims may also be entitled to workers' compensation benefits.
Aspects of a Successful Mesothelioma Lawsuit
Showing Exposure: Victims require to develop that their mesothelioma was brought on by asbestos exposure, often needing medical records and work history.

Recognizing Responsible Parties: This includes pinpointing business or manufacturers that stopped working to provide safe environments or concealed the dangers of asbestos.

Collecting Evidence: Gathering medical records, work history, and other pertinent files is important for developing a strong case.

Frequently Asked Questions About Mesothelioma Legal Assistance in Louisiana1. What is the statute of constraints for filing a mesothelioma claim in Louisiana?
The statute of constraints in Louisiana normally permits victims to file an injury claim within one year from the date of diagnosis. For wrongful death claims, the time limit is one year from the date of death.
2. How much compensation can I get out of a mesothelioma lawsuit?
Compensation can differ widely based upon private cases, consisting of elements like the degree of exposure, the intensity of health problem, and readily available insurance or trust funds. Victims might get compensation ranging from thousands to millions of dollars.
3. Can I still file a claim if I dealt with asbestos decades ago?
Yes, even if the exposure took place several years earlier, victims might still be eligible to submit claims. Mesothelioma can take decades to establish, and courts typically recognize this delay.
4. What if the accountable party is no longer in business?
In numerous circumstances, bankrupt companies accountable for asbestos exposure have produced trust funds to compensate victims. Experienced attorneys can assist you through the claims process for these funds.
5. Do I have to go to court to get compensation?
Not always. Numerous mesothelioma cases are settled out of court through negotiations between the parties included. Nevertheless, if a fair settlement can not be reached, your attorney may suggest proceeding to trial.
